    Abstract: Provided are a method and a device for decoding a Picture Order Count (POC), and a method and a device for coding a POC, and electronic equipment. The method for decoding the POC includes that: parameters for Most Significant Bit (MSB) and Least Significant Bit (LSB) used in an alignment operation on the POC are acquired; an MSB value and an LSB value of a POC value of a current picture are determined according to the parameters for MSB and LSB; and the POC value of the current picture is calculated according to the MSB value and the LSB value. By means of the technical solution, the problems in the related art that the accuracy in decoding and outputting a multilayer video bitstream cannot be ensured and an extra overhead of network resources is increased in multilayer video coding and decoding processes are solved.

    Abstract: The present disclosure provides picture encoding and decoding methods, picture encoding and decoding devices as well as a decoder and an encoder. The picture decoding method includes: parsing a video bitstream to obtain candidate reshaping parameters from a picture-layer and/or slice-layer data unit of the video bitstream, and determining a reshaping parameter used for reshaping a reconstructed picture according to the obtained candidate reshaping parameters; and reshaping the reconstructed picture by using the reshaping parameter. The reconstructed picture is a picture obtained by decoding the video bitstream before performing the reshaping. The picture-layer and/or slice-layer data unit includes at least one of the following data units: a picture-layer parameter set and/or a slice-layer parameter set different from a picture parameter set (PPS), a parameter data unit which are included in an access unit (AU) corresponding to the reconstructed picture, slice header and a system-layer picture parameter data unit.
